Hi all. for the past couple of months, I have been noticing decreasing performance in my PC. I have an 8700k that is not overclocked and yet for some reason even with a liquid cooler I am idling at 90c. I have updated the motherboard bios, drivers, receded the CPU, and even purchased a new liquid cooler. All of which have not solved my issue. The PC is used strictly for light gaming and school work so why are the temps getting so out ragous? Really looking for some help.
 
Solution
for some reason even with a liquid cooler I am idling at 90c. I have purchased a new liquid cooler.
Either cooler has failed (dead pump, clogged cpu block) or
not installed properly (pump not connected, thermal paste not applied properly, protective film on cpu block not removed, cooler not properly secured).

Get your pc to a service center, so they check everything and install cpu cooler properly.
